图书介绍

嵌入式系统原理与应用技术 第2版pdf电子书版本下载

嵌入式系统原理与应用技术  第2版
  • 袁志勇,王景存主编;章登义,刘树波副主编 著
  • 出版社: 北京:北京航空航天大学出版社
  • ISBN:9787512414679
  • 出版时间:2014
  • 标注页数:366页
  • 文件大小:55MB
  • 文件页数:378页
  • 主题词:微型计算机-系统设计-教材

PDF下载


点此进入-本书在线PDF格式电子书下载【推荐-云解压-方便快捷】直接下载PDF格式图书。移动端-PC端通用
下载压缩包 [复制下载地址] 温馨提示:(请使用BT下载软件FDM进行下载)软件下载地址页

下载说明

嵌入式系统原理与应用技术 第2版PDF格式电子书版下载

下载的文件为RAR压缩包。需要使用解压软件进行解压得到PDF格式图书。

建议使用BT下载工具Free Download Manager进行下载,简称FDM(免费,没有广告,支持多平台)。本站资源全部打包为BT种子。所以需要使用专业的BT下载软件进行下载。如 BitComet qBittorrent uTorrent等BT下载工具。迅雷目前由于本站不是热门资源。不推荐使用!后期资源热门了。安装了迅雷也可以迅雷进行下载!

(文件页数 要大于 标注页数,上中下等多册电子书除外)

注意:本站所有压缩包均有解压码: 点击下载压缩包解压工具

图书目录

第1章 嵌入式系统概论 1

1.1嵌入式系统简介 1

1.1.1嵌入式系统的定义 1

1.1.2嵌入式系统的组成 2

1.1.3嵌入式系统的应用与发展 5

1.2嵌入式微处理器 7

1.2.1嵌入式微处理器分类 7

1.2.2 ARM嵌入式微处理器 10

1.2.3嵌入式微处理器选型 14

1.3嵌入式操作系统 15

1.3.1概况 15

1.3.2 Windows CE简介 15

1.3.3嵌入式Linux简介 16

1.3.4 μC/OS-Ⅱ简介 17

习题 20

第2章ARM9体系结构 21

2.1 ARM9嵌入式微处理器 21

2.1.1 ARM9的结构特点 21

2.1.2 ARM9指令集特点 24

2.1.3 ARM9工作模式 26

2.2 ARM9存储器组织结构 28

2.2.1大端存储和小端存储 28

2.2.2 I/O端口的访问方式 30

2.2.3内部寄存器 30

2.3 ARM9异常 35

2.3.1异常的类型及向量地址 36

2.3.2异常的优先级 38

2.3.3进入和退出异常 38

2.4 S3C2410嵌入式微处理器 42

2.4.1 S3C2410及片内外围简介 42

2.4.2 S3C2410引脚信号 44

2.4.3 S3C2410专用寄存器 49

2.4.4 ARM920T总线接口单元简介 55

习题 55

第3章ARM指令系统 56

3.1 ARM指令集 56

3.1.1 ARM指令分类及格式 56

3.1.2 ARM指令寻址方式 58

3.1.3常用ARM指令 64

3.2 ARM汇编伪指令与伪操作 79

3.2.1常用ARM汇编伪指令 79

3.2.2常用ARM汇编伪操作 81

3.3 Thumb指令集简介 86

3.4 ARM编程基础 87

3.4.1 ARM程序常用文件格式 87

3.4.2 ARM预定义变量 87

3.4.3 C语言与汇编混合编程 88

3.5 ADS 1.2集成开发环境的使用 91

3.5.1 ADS 1.2使用介绍 91

3.5.2使用ADS 1.2设计汇编程序举例 93

习题 100

第4章 时钟及电源管理 101

4.1 S3C2410时钟结构 101

4.2 S3C2410电源管理模式 101

4.3相关特殊功能寄存器 106

4.4常用单元电路设计 110

4.4.1电源电路设计 110

4.4.2晶振电路设计 112

4.4.3复位电路设计 113

习题 113

第5章 存储器与I/O接口原理 114

5.1存储器概述 114

5.1.1 SRAM和DRAM 115

5.1.2 NOR Flash和NAND Flash 121

5.2存储系统机制 125

5.2.1存储器接口方式 126

5.2.2高速缓存机制(Cache) 126

5.2.3存储管理单元(MMU) 128

5.3 S3C2410存储系统 130

5.3.1 S3C2410存储空间 130

5.3.2 S3C2410存储器接口设计 137

5.4 S3C2410I/O端口 142

5.4.1 I/O端口控制寄存器 142

5.4.2 I/O端口应用举例 143

习题 144

第6章 中断与定时技术 145

6.1中断概述 145

6.1.1中断向量 145

6.1.2中断优先级 146

6.1.3中断屏蔽 147

6.2 S3C2410中断系统 148

6.2.1概述 148

6.2.2中断控制寄存器 151

6.2.3中断举例 161

6.3定时器工作原理 164

6.3.1概述 164

6.3.2工作原理 164

6.4 S3C2410定时器 165

6.4.1定时器及PWM 165

6.4.2看门狗定时器 175

6.4.3 RTC 177

习题 187

第7章DMA技术 188

7.1 DMA概述 188

7.1.1 DMA简介 188

7.1.2 DMA传输过程 188

7.2 S3C2410 DMA 190

7.2.1 DMA请求源 190

7.2.2 DMA模式 191

7.2.3 DMA操作过程 192

7.2.4 DMA时序 193

7.3 S3C2410 DMA寄存器 195

7.3.1传输控制寄存器 195

7.3.2状态寄存器 199

7.4 DMA操作编程 200

7.4.1 DMA操作初始化 200

7.4.2 DMA操作编程举例 200

习题 202

第8章 串行通信接口 203

8.1串行通信基础知识 203

8.1.1串行数据传送模式 203

8.1.2串行通信方式 204

8.1.3 RS - 232C串行通信接口 206

8.1.4 RS-422和RS-485标准 208

8.2 S3C2410串行接口 208

8.2.1 S3C2410 UART结构 209

8.2.2 S3C2410 UART工作原理 210

8.2.3 S3C2410 UART专用寄存器 212

8.3串行通信举例 219

8.3.1 RS-232C接口设计 219

8.3.2串口初始化 220

8.3.3发送/接收程序举例 221

8.4 IIS串行数字音频接口 223

8.4.1 IIS接口总线格式 227

8.4.2 IIS接口应用举例 228

习题 231

第9章 网络接口 232

9.1网络接口技术概述 232

9.1.1分布嵌入式系统结构 232

9.1.2分布嵌入式网络通信方式 234

9.2 IIC接口 235

9.2.1 IIC总线 235

9.2.2 S3C2410IIC接口 239

9.3 CAN总线接口 246

9.3.1 CAN总线 246

9.3.2 CAN接口 250

9.4以太网接口 252

9.4.1嵌入式以太网基础知识 253

9.4.2 S3C2410以太网接口 259

9.4.3 socket网络编程 265

9.4.4嵌入式Web服务器程序设计 275

习题 282

第10章 人机接口 283

10.1键盘接口 283

10.1.1按键的识别 283

10.1.2键盘接口举例 285

10.2 LED显示器 288

10.2.1 LED显示控制原理 289

10.2.2 LED接口举例 291

10.3 LCD接口 294

10.3.1 LCD显示控制原理 294

10.3.2 S3C2410 LCD控制器 296

10.3.3 S3C2410 LCD寄存器 299

10.3.4 LCD接口举例 306

10.4 ADC和触摸屏接口 310

10.4.1触摸屏的种类 310

10.4.2 S3C2410 ADC和触摸屏 312

10.4.3 ADC和触摸屏接口举例 316

习题 321

第11章Linux操作系统基础 322

11.1 Linux操作系统概述 322

11.1.1 Linux的发展历程 322

11.1.2 Linux的特点 324

11.2 Linux内核的结构 325

11.2.1进程管理 326

11.2.2内存管理 328

11.2.3虚拟文件系统 330

11.2.4网络接口 331

11.2.5进程间通信 332

11.3 Linux设备管理 334

11.3.1字符设备 334

11.3.2块设备 335

11.3.3可安装模块 336

11.4 Linux的使用 339

11.4.1 Linux常用命令 339

11.4.2 vi编辑器的使用 342

11.4.3 gcc编译器和make工具 346

11.4.4 gdb调试 349

11.5 Linux的安装 350

11.5.1目前流行的Linux发行版本 350

11.5.2 Linux安装在独立的硬盘分区 351

11.5.3 Linux安装在虚拟机中 351

习题 352

附录1 S3C2410引脚功能表 353

附录2 ARM汇编程序上机实验举例 358

实验一ARM汇编程序的上机过程实验 358

实验二ARM指令寻址方式实验 362

参考文献 366

精品推荐